CardName: Elite Pikemen Cost: 1W Type: Creature - Human Soldier Pow/Tgh: 2/1 Rules Text: Elite Pikemen can block as though it had Horsemanship. Flavour Text: Nothing disperses a cavalry charge like a wall of pikes wielded by well trained and disciplined soldiers. Set/Rarity: Urthona Common |

Were you planning on having green creatures with Horsemanship? Are you sure that Horsemanreach shouldn't be a green ability?
Yes, green will get a few centaurs and maybe an elf with Horsemanship. Green already gets anti-flying so it doesn't really need anti-horsemanship, especially if it is getting a good dose of it.
Like you've said in places, I think Horsemanship should be treated much differently than flying. I like that it's in green as its secondary color. Also, this only needs to say "can block as though it had Horsemanship." You don't need the "assigned to."
Thanks. Yeah whilst it was originally created to replace flying in Portal Three Kingdoms, it should be treated as totally different. And, whilst it is called HORSEmanship I don't see that it needs be limited to actual horses. Goblins on boars or lizards, elves on beasts of the forest etc can all use the ability to give it more depth.
